About the role

  • Planning and design of complex plants, retrofits and modernizations in our electric steelworks, including project management
  • Ensuring the maintenance and further development of our mechanical plant technology and equipment
  • Participation in troubleshooting/analysis and optimization of our processes
  • Lead by example in occupational safety, actively promoting and enforcing safe practices
  • Work in the PTG teams for environmental and energy management, conduct and support audits, and optimize energy consumption
  • Serve as the designated plant-responsible person in accordance with the AwSV regulation
  • Participation in on-call duty

Requirements

  • Completed Bachelor's degree, preferably a Master's degree, in Mechanical Engineering
  • At least 3 years of relevant experience in maintenance with strong knowledge of fluid power systems (hydraulics/pneumatics)
  • Good knowledge of technical regulations and project planning methods
  • Very good German and good English, both written and spoken
  • Reliable, committed individual with a high degree of responsibility and strong organizational skills
  • Fit for work in a steelworks environment and for work at heights (required)
